Real Madrid vs. Manchester City Champions League Quarterfinal Set

Madrid, Spain - March 11, 2026 - The footballing world holds its breath as Real Madrid and Manchester City prepare to clash once more, this time in the first leg of their highly anticipated Champions League quarterfinal showdown. Scheduled for Tuesday, April 7, 2026, the match promises a captivating spectacle of skill, strategy, and intense competition. For U.S. viewers, Paramount+ will be the exclusive broadcaster, offering both live television coverage and streaming options.

This isn't simply a game; it's a rematch steeped in recent history, a continuation of a budding rivalry that has delivered dramatic moments and unforgettable encounters. While Manchester City has ascended to become a dominant force in English football, consistently challenging for and winning domestic titles, their European aspirations have been repeatedly thwarted by the historical giants of Real Madrid. The question on everyone's lips is: can City finally overcome the Madrid hurdle?

Kick-Off Times Around the Globe

To cater to a global audience, kickoff times will vary. Here's a breakdown of when fans can tune in:

  • Eastern Time (ET): 3:00 p.m.
  • Central Time (CT): 2:00 p.m.
  • Mountain Time (MT): 1:00 p.m.
  • Pacific Time (PT): 12:00 p.m.
  • British Summer Time (BST): 8:00 p.m.
  • Central European Time (CET): 9:00 p.m.

The Ancelotti-Guardiola Chess Match

The tactical battle between Real Madrid's Carlo Ancelotti and Manchester City's Pep Guardiola is arguably the most compelling aspect of this fixture. Both managers are renowned for their tactical acumen and ability to adapt to opponents. Ancelotti, a master of pragmatism, often prioritizes defensive solidity and clinical counter-attacking football. Guardiola, on the other hand, is a proponent of possession-based, attacking football, aiming to dominate the midfield and overwhelm opponents with intricate passing patterns. Their contrasting philosophies consistently lead to a fascinating strategic duel.

This season, both managers have demonstrated a willingness to tweak their formations and personnel based on the opposition. Expect both to analyze the other's strengths and weaknesses meticulously, devising plans to exploit vulnerabilities and neutralize key threats. The midfield battle will be crucial, with both teams likely to field a constellation of world-class players vying for control of the game's central areas.

Key Player Matchups: Vinicius Jr. vs. Kyle Walker

Beyond the overarching tactical battle, several individual matchups are set to define the contest. One of the most intriguing is the duel between Real Madrid's explosive winger, Vinicius Jr., and Manchester City's athletic and experienced right-back, Kyle Walker. Vinicius's pace, dribbling skills, and direct running pose a significant threat to any defense, while Walker's recovery speed and defensive prowess make him one of the best in the world at containing such threats. This battle of speed and skill will be a compelling subplot throughout the match.

Another crucial contest will likely be in midfield, where Real Madrid's Toni Kroos and Luka Modric will face off against City's Rodri and Kevin De Bruyne. The ability of each team to control the tempo and dictate play through the middle of the park will be paramount.
